android签名打包发布到应用市场
2017-03-21 20:26
429 查看
android签名打包发布到应用市场
一 主题
本篇文章详细介绍android从签名打包到发布到应用市场的流程,以及遇到的问题,二,版本1.0.0
首先说一下你的apk第一个版本的发布,
1,创建签名文件keystore,首先你要完成好你的项目….,然后通过androidstudio底部的命令行工具输入: keytool -genkey alias MyKey.jks -keyalg RSA -validity 20000 -keystore MyKey.jks
MyKey为你要生成的jks(之前esclipse称为keystore)名称,
2,3,使用jks文件给i你的apk签名
使用一下命令:jarsigner -verbose -keystore MyKey.jks -signedjar app_360.apk app_360.apk mykey 这句命令里面含有四个参数:第一个参数MyKey.jks是上面我们生成的jks文件名称,第二个参数app_360.apk为你要签名的apk文件名称,第三个参数app_360.apk也是apk名称,最后一个参数为你的jks文件的别名key Alias。
4,发布到应用市场
通过以上几部我们已经拿到了签名过的apk,然后怎么发布到应用市场呢?我们拿360市场来说,因为360相对与其他市场来说相对麻烦一些。
(1)首先登录360开放平台 http://dev.360.cn/
(2)进入管理中心创建软件,填写一些资质信息,当然这些资料你们老大应该已经给你了或者已经做好了,接下来要做的就是上传apk了,
(3 重点) 上传apk之后360会强制要求对apk进行加固,加固之后他会提示下载360已经加固好的apk,然后拿着这个apk重新进行一次签名,也就是重新执行之前我们执行的第二部,然后在重新上传即可
三:版本1.0.1
版本更新就比较简单了,你只需要把你apk做好versionCode,versionName设置,然后重复以上的步
4000
骤就OK了,
本篇文章基于androidstudio操作,所有命令都是在当前项目根目录下操作.
相关文章推荐
- ionic3应用的Android打包签名发布步骤
- Android 应用:打包(签名文件)、代码混淆、应用加固、发布到应用商店
- Android应用市场(发布APK)及多渠道打包
- ionic应用的Android打包签名发布步骤
- 柔弱的APP如何自我保护,浅谈APP防御手段,使用360加固助手加固/签名/多渠道打包/应用市场发布
- Android签名打包上架应用包市场
- Android应用开发之软件打包与发布,生成私钥签名你的软件
- 柔弱的APP如何自我保护,浅谈APP防御手段,使用360加固助手加固/签名/多渠道打包/应用市场发布
- 如何发布打包并发布自己的Android应用(续)
- android 应用 Ant脚本自动编译、打包、代码混淆、签名、安装等
- Android 发布应用到市场
- Android 发布应用到市场
- android应用如何在发布市场时关掉所有的Log日志输出
- eclipse+ADT 进行android应用签名打包详解
- Android应用市场和发布流程参考
- eclipse+ADT 进行android应用签名打包详解
- Android批量打渠道包提速 - 1分钟900个市场不是梦(无须重新编译无须重新签名无须重新打包)
- Android应用apk的调试模式签名和发布模式签名
- android应用市场源码发布【第二天】
- eclipse+ADT 进行android应用签名打包详解